Condor is now utilizing Unmanned Aerial Systems (UAS), more commonly known as drones, to perform a variety of data collection and analysis projects. We are able to use UAS to capture high-resolution imagery; with powerful processing techniques to render real-life visualization tools for planners, engineers, construction teams and others. These models of infrastructure, landscapes, and geologic features produce high-resolution design tools that accurately depict terrain and elevations. This data is produced in a significantly shorter timeframe than traditional methods, which translates to decreased acquisition costs. We have the capability to provide high-resolution aerial imagery, time-lapse aerial imagery, aerial video inspections, digital elevation models, scaled 3D-models and other products. All of Condor’s UAS projects have been facilitated by a federally licensed and insured UAS pilot.
Condor’s broad base of experience and expertise allows us to blend state-of-the-art data collection with powerful GIS data analytics. Some examples of our UAS portfolio include documenting spillway conditions, including cracks and anomalies, to comply with state regulations; estimating landslide volumes in engineering alternatives reports for road failures; providing post-construction aerial imagery to document solar panel installation; and documenting watershed boundaries affecting reservoir capacity.
